What made VLIW a good fit for DSPs compared to GPUs?


Why didn’t DSPs evolve toward vector accelerators instead of VLIW, despite having highly regular data-parallel workloads


  👤 dlcarrier Accepted Answer ✓
That's not a real dichotomy. A RISC processor can range from completely lacking vector instructions to including complex matrix multiplications, and a so can a VLIW processor.

As far as why there are architectural differences between DSPs and GPUs, the largest reason is that DSPs are designed for processing one-dimensional data, like sensor readings or audio, where as GPUs are designed to process two-dimensional data, like pictures and video. Adding a dimension greatly increases the complexity of the data-processing algorithms the device will be running.
